di_minor_next(3DEVINFO) Device Information Library Functions di_minor_next(3DEVINFO)
NAME
di_minor_next - libdevinfo minor node traversal functions
SYNOPSIS
cc [ flag... ] file... -ldevinfo [ library... ]
#include <libdevinfo.h>
di_minor_t di_minor_next(di_node_t node, di_minor_t minor);
PARAMETERS
minor Handle to the current minor node or DI_MINOR_NIL.
node Device node with which the minor node is associated.
DESCRIPTION
The di_minor_next() function returns a handle to the next minor node for the device node node. If minor is DI_MINOR_NIL, a handle to the
first minor node is returned.
RETURN VALUES
Upon successful completion, a handle to the next minor node is returned. Otherwise, DI_MINOR_NIL is returned and errno is set to indicate
the error.
ERRORS
The di_minor_next() function will fail if:
EINVAL Invalid argument.
ENOTSUP Minor node information is not available in snapshot.
ENXIO End of minor node list.
